Role Responsibilities

  • Cycle Count Inventory
  • Conduct ongoing cycle counts throughout the 6 month assignment to verify quantities and correct discrepancies.
  • Update Inventory System
  • Enter missing parts, update descriptions, correct quantities, and ensure all part data is complete and accurate.
  • Parts Room Organization
  • Reorganize shelves, label parts, and maintain a clean, efficient storage layout.
  • Process Excess Parts
  • Identify excess or misplaced parts located outside the parts room and determine what should be returned to inventory.
  • SHELVING & STOCKING
  • Place excess or newly identified parts onto the correct shelves following company standards.
  • Documentation Cleanup
  • Over the 6 month period ensure all part descriptions, categories, and locations are fully updated and standardized.
  • Support Inventory Audit
  • Assist with mid assignment and end of assignment inventory checks to confirm improvements.
  • Assist Staff
  • Help technicians and team members locate parts and answer questions about availability.
